body{
	margin:0;
	padding:0;
	background-image:url(/img/back.gif);
	background-repeat:repeat-x;
	background-position:top left;
	background-color:#936aa4;
		font-family:"Trebuchet MS", "Myriad Pro", Calibri, sans-serif;
}
.mainbox ul {}

.containermain{
	width:820px;
	margin-left:auto;
	margin-right:auto;	
	background-image:url(/img/fade-back.png);
}

.container{
	width:820px;
	margin-left:auto;
	margin-right:auto;	
	background-image:url(/img/background.png);
	background-position:top;
	background-repeat:no-repeat;
}

	
.header{
background-image:url(/img/top.png);
height:202px}

.footer{
background-image:url(/img/bottom.png);
width:800px;
height:22px;
margin-left:10px;
margin-right:10px;
clear:both;
}


#top-nav{
	padding:25px 25px 0 0 ;
	margin:0;
	list-style:none;
	margin-left:auto;
	margin-right:auto;
	height:31px;
	float:right}
	
#top-nav li{
	float:right;
	text-indent:-10000px;
	height:31px}

#top-nav li a{
	display:block;
	height:31px;
	background-position:0 0}

#top-nav li a:hover{
	background-position: 0 32px;}
	
#top-nav-home a{
	background-image:url(/img/top-menu-home.png);
	width:57px}
#top-nav-mail a{
	background-image:url(/img/top-menu-email.png);
	width:192px}
#top-nav-work a{
	background-image:url(/img/top-menu-work-with-us.png);
	width:92px}
	
.main-content{
	margin-left:10px;
	margin-right:10px;
}

.normlink{background-image:none;height:auto}

#content-home{

}


#menu{
	padding:60px 0  10px 0;
	margin:0;
	list-style:none;
	margin-left:auto;
	margin-right:auto;
	float:left;
	width:180px;}
	
#menu li{
	text-indent:-10000px;
	height:28px;
	width:180px;
	margin-top:8px;
	display:block;}

#menu li a{
	display:block;
	width:180px;
	background-position:0 0;
	}

#menu li a:hover{
	background-position:180px 0}
.on{
	background-position:180px 0}
	
#menu-it a#mit{
	background-image:url(/img/menu_it.png);
	height:28px;
	
	}
	





	
#menu-ci a#mci{
	background-image:url(/img/menu_ci.png);
	height:28px;
	}
	
#menu-t a#mt{
	background-image:url(/img/menu_t.png);
	height:28px;
	}
	
#menu-ots a#mots{
	background-image:url(/img/menu_ots.png);
	height:28px;
	}
	
#menu-be a#mbe{
	background-image:url(/img/menu_be.png);
	height:28px;
	}
	
#menu-p a#mp{
	background-image:url(/img/menu_p.png);
	height:28px;
	}
	
	
	
	
.copyright{ 
color:#dbd3d6;
font-family:Geneva, Arial, Helvetica, sans-serif;
font-size:10px;
text-align:center;
padding-top:10px;}

.copyright a, .copyright a:hover{ 
color:#dbd3d6;
text-decoration:none}

.mchome{
	background-image:url(/img/home-home.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cnormal{
	background-image:url(/img/home-normal.png);
	background-repeat:no-repeat;
	background-position:top;}
	
	
	
.mcit{
	background-image:url(/img/it_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cit-back{
	background-image:url(/img/it_back.png);}
.mcit-bottom{
	background-image:url(/img/it_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	
	
.mcci{
	background-image:url(/img/ci_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cci-back{
	background-image:url(/img/ci_back.png);}
.mcci-bottom{
	background-image:url(/img/ci_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	
	
.mct{
	background-image:url(/img/t_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mct-back{
	background-image:url(/img/t_back.png);}
.mct-bottom{
	background-image:url(/img/t_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	
	
.mcots{
	background-image:url(/img/ots_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cots-back{
	background-image:url(/img/ots_back.png);}
.mcots-bottom{
	background-image:url(/img/ots_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	
	
.mcbe{
	background-image:url(/img/be_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cbe-back{
	background-image:url(/img/be_back.png);}
.mcbe-bottom{
	background-image:url(/img/be_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	.on{}
	
.mcp{
	background-image:url(/img/p_top.png);
	background-repeat:no-repeat;
	background-position:top;}
.mcp-back{
	background-image:url(/img/p_back.png);}
.mcp-bottom{
	background-image:url(/img/p_bottom.png);
	background-repeat:no-repeat;
	background-position:bottom right;}
	
	font[size=1]{font-size:8pt;}
	font[size=2]{font-size:9pt;}
	font[size=3]{font-size:10pt;}
	font[size=4]{font-size:11pt;}
	font[size=5]{font-size:12pt;}
	font[size=6]{font-size:13pt;}
	font[size=7]{font-size:14pt;}
	font[size=8]{font-size:15pt;}
	font[size=9]{font-size:16pt;}
	font[size=10]{font-size:18pt;}
	font[size=11]{font-size:20pt;}
	font[size=12]{font-size:24pt;}
	
p,div{ font-family:Arial, Helvetica, sans-serif; font-size:11px;  color:#4c2432}

h1{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:19px; font-weight:bold; color:#4c2432}
h2{font-family:Verdana, Arial, Helvetica, sans-serif; font-size:19px; font-weight:bold; color:#845597}
h3{font-family:Arial, Helvetica, sans-serif; font-size:16px; font-weight:bold; color:#845597}
h4{font-family:Arial, Helvetica, sans-serif; font-size:17px; font-weight:bold; color:#4c2432}

.menulink{height:auto;text-indent:0px;font-size:11px;width:150px;color:#4c2432;padding:0 0 0 14px;margin:0;text-decoration:none;}

.menulink:hover{color:white}
.menulink:active{color:white}

.toplink{color:#4c2432}
.toplink:hover{color:white}
.toplink:active{color:white}

